Day 5 - Abu Simbel

After breakfast, the most magnificent of the monuments Ramses II built, Abu Simbel is both the perfect example of the ambition of this pharaoh's reign and also a model illustration of the achievements of modern engineering and global cooperation. The entire temple complex was transplanted from its original location and lifted piece by piece to its current site by an international UNESCO team working against the clock to preserve it from being flooded by the Aswan High Dam in the 1960s. The colossal stone statues that grace the facade are Pharaoh Ramses II's attempt to achieve immortality. Egypt's ancient center for the cult of Isis, the Temples of Philae were venerated from the Pharaonic era through the Greek, Roman, and Byzantine periods with each ruler making their own additions to the stones here. This sacred site has dazzled travelers as it one of Nubia's most important monument sites. It was saved from a watery grave by UNESCO's rescue project during the building of the Aswan High Dam; the temples were transferred block by block from their original place on Philae Island to Agilika Island, 12 kilometers south of Aswan. Thanks to this, today travelers can still walk amid the columns of this ancient venerated site
